Output ed2ecaa30f7905932bfb541cbf071c8fbd146e472a84ccb1b2e6bebe34f9ee2d:1

value
25111788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ec3b5c6f701bd5d273184c400d67219bc90f8d OP_EQUAL
address
3M1ZVhUeXZEehuDeyxFbt19GnJrRhJv4Xq
transaction
ed2ecaa30f7905932bfb541cbf071c8fbd146e472a84ccb1b2e6bebe34f9ee2d
confirmations
355953
spent
true